How to take screens

Is there a way to take screen shots in lunar magic or at least a program that lets you take screen shots. PS im asking for screen shots that are not in game. I'm asking this because i need to know how to take pictures of ExGFX in 16x16 editors...
The print screen button on your keyboard.

Hold alt and it will only capture the selected window!
Thanks but were does it save too? It's not on my desktop so were?
In the clipboard.

Go to paint or some program and hit ctrl+V. Then you can save that picture.
Windows: Prt Scr -> Paste in Paint.
Mac OS: Apple Button + Shift + 3/4.
Linux: Prt Scr, and that's all.

If you would like to take multiple Screenshot with multiple button presses, i would suggest a program called UOSU
(Ultima Online Screen Utility)
just press the print screen key and it automatically saves whatever's on screen to a picture.
If you have windows vista, you can use a tool called snipping tool. Its in the accesories folder under programs. what sucks about this one is that it leaves a red border around the picture.
If you want to take direct screenshots of snes games, go into ZSNES and press F1 and then select TAKE SNAPSHOT. A small screenshot of what's on screen will appear in the game's folder, or wherever you set the path to. :/

For best results, switch the image format to .PNG
